TEXTRON AVIATION


We are seeking a highly skilled and detail-oriented Data Analyst to join our Supply Chain team. As a Data Analyst, you will be responsible for collecting, analyzing, and interpreting large datasets to provide valuable insights and support data-driven decision-making processes within the Supply Chain department. Your expertise in data analysis, statistical modeling, and data visualization will play a vital role in optimizing our operations, improving efficiency, and driving overall business success.


•Bachelor's degree in a relevant field (e.g., Data Science, Statistics, Engineering, or Computer Science).

•Proven experience as a Data Analyst, preferably in the manufacturing industry.

•Proficiency in statistical analysis tools and programming languages such as Python, R, or SQL.

•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to extract meaningful insights from complex datasets.

•Familiarity with data visualization tools (e.g., Tableau, Power BI) to create compelling visualizations and reports.

•Knowledge of manufacturing processes, supply chain management, and production systems.

•Understanding of data management principles and best practices, including data cleansing, validation, and storage.

•Excellent communication and presentation skills, with the ability to effectively convey techn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.

•Strong attention to detail and a commitment to data accuracy and integrity.

•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ced manufacturing environment.
